Time of Update: 2018-07-26
前言:記得自己在學習資料結構的時候,在進位轉換的時候通過遞迴實現過,也通過堆棧實現過,但是在JavaScript中有一個非常方便的方法可以實現進位轉換,下面分享一下堆棧的寫法以及JavaScript中最簡單的寫法 堆棧實現方法 <!DOCTYPE html><html lang="en"><head> <meta charset="UTF-8"> <title>Document&
Time of Update: 2018-07-26
摘要:“如果你不能向一個六歲的孩子解釋清楚,那麼其實你自己根本就沒弄懂。 ”好吧,我試著向一個27歲的朋友就是JS閉包(JavaScript closure)卻徹底失敗了。 越來越覺得國內沒有教書育人的氛圍,為了弄懂JS的閉包,我使出了我英語四級吃奶的勁去google上搜尋著有關閉包的解釋,當我看到stackoverflow上這一篇解答,我腦中就出現了一句話:就是這貨沒跑了。 不才譯文見下,見笑了。 Peter Mortensen問: 就像老Albert所說的,“
Time of Update: 2018-07-26
ArcGIS API for JavaScript 4.X 版本升級後,API發生了很大的變化。 其中就支援了WebEarth展示,主要是通過 esri/views/SceneView 實現的。 在新版本中,預設都是載入Esri自己的地圖。 若想載入其他地圖,可以通過擴充BaseTileLayer實現。 例如,最新版本載入高德地圖的demo如下: <!DOCTYPE html><html><head>
Time of Update: 2018-07-26
代碼1:<title>Happy New Year</title><body bgcolor="#ff3300" leftmargin="0" topmargin="0" onLoad="snow()" AAAD98><script language="JavaScript"><!-- N = 100; Y = new Array();X =
Time of Update: 2018-07-26
代碼1:<title>Happy New Year</title><body bgcolor="#ff3300" leftmargin="0" topmargin="0" onLoad="snow()" AAAD98><script language="JavaScript"><!-- N = 100; Y = new
Time of Update: 2018-07-26
javascript廣告漂浮效果代碼 本例主要是網頁漂浮廣告代碼,就是一個小框框在網頁裡漂浮。這個網頁漂浮廣告的實現也很簡單,在網頁中通過javascript尋找id為img1的div,然後通過js代碼來實現網頁內的漂浮廣告。 很簡單的一個div,然後調用js.js去控制這個div 看網頁漂浮廣告代碼裡js.js的代碼 <script type="text/javascript">var x=0;var y=0;var vx=1;var vy=1;/
Time of Update: 2018-07-26
深入理解javascript原型鏈 在javascript中原型和原型鏈是一個很神奇的東西,對於大多數人也是最難理解的一部分,掌握原型和原型鏈的本質是javascript進階的重要一環。今天我分享一下我對javascript原型和原型鏈的理解。 一、對象等級劃分 我們認為在javascript任何值或變數都是對象,但是我還需要將javascript中的對象分為一下幾個等級。 首先Object是頂級公民,
Time of Update: 2018-07-26
*今天總結一下JavaScript的prototype原型和*____proto____原型鏈,瞭解這倆對我們深刻理解 js ,封裝常用小技巧很有協助。 ES5中js本身是沒有類的,在ES5中js類就是函數function,而function本身也是對象。 一、js中的繼承是通過原型鏈 __proto__來實現的,對象與對象以及原型prototype(也是對象)就是通過__proto__原型鏈來來連結的,具體過程我們來上代碼說明。 function obj (name){
Time of Update: 2018-07-26
Javascript將統治世界 在1999年,一個平常人就可以使用FrontPage做一個簡單的個人網站(後來出來了開源的Discuz和BLOG),不過對於HTML/CSS/Javscript的簡單性普及性可見一斑。在2010年,你要尋找一名移動APP的開發人員,甭管經驗如何,沒有1萬一個月你搞不定,這還是Android用JAVA開發應用的現狀下。
Time of Update: 2018-07-26
要弄清楚原型鏈就要先弄清楚 function 類型,在javascript中沒有類的概念,都是函數,所以它是一門函數式的程式設計語言。類有一個很重要的特性,就是它可以根據它的建構函式來建立以它為模板的對象。在javascript中,函數就有2個功能 第一、 作為一般函數調用 第二、 作為它原型對象的建構函式 也就new() 我們來看一個例子 function a(){this.name = 'a';} 當建立一個函數,它會發生什麼呢。
Time of Update: 2018-07-26
幾年之前學習過Javascript,當時學得比較淺顯,現在又開始學了,發現Javascript其實挺難的,有些地方還是得花時間去理解的,於是看了很多的視頻和部落格,自己在這裡小小的總結下。。。 1.一切(參考型別)都是對象,對象是屬性的集合。 undefined, number, string,
Time of Update: 2018-07-26
JavaScript中原型和原型鏈詳解 投稿:junjie 字型:[增加 減小] 類型:轉載 時間:2015-02-11 我要評論 這篇文章主要介紹了JavaScript中原型和原型鏈詳解,本文講解了私人變數和函數、靜態變數和函數、執行個體變數和函數、原型和原型鏈的基本概念,需要的朋友可以參考下 <iframe id="iframeu2261530_0"
Time of Update: 2018-07-26
1.函數實際上是對象,函數名實際上是一個指向函數對象的指標。 function sum(num1,num2){ return num1+num2;}alert(sum(10,10));//20var anotherSum=sum;alert(anotherSum(10,10));//20sum=null;alert(anotherSum(10,10));//20 因此沒有重載,同名函數,後者會覆蓋前者。 2.函式宣告和函數運算式 //正常運行alert(sum(10,10)
Time of Update: 2018-07-26
Javascript 點擊按鈕 提示確認 確認後跳轉網頁 可傳遞參數: <html><head><script type="text/javascript">function show_confirm(var){var r=confirm("Press a button!");if (r==true) { window.location.href='http://test/?param='+var;
Time of Update: 2018-07-26
1.Boolean類型 Boolean類型是與布爾值對應的參考型別。 var falseObject=new Boolean(flase);alert(falseObject&&true);//true;var falseObject=false;alert(falseObject&&true);//false 沒事兒不要用Boolean類型~~~ 2.Number類型 toString(),可以加一個參數表示進位: var num=1
Time of Update: 2018-07-26
http://blog.csdn.net/yansanhu/article/details/5413360 本文介紹怎麼使用javascript Location對象讀和修改Url.怎麼重載或重新整理頁面。 javascript提供了許多方法訪問,修改目前使用者在瀏覽器中訪問的url.所有的這些技術都是基於location對象的。它是作為window對象的屬性。你可以產生一個包含當前url的新location對象:
Time of Update: 2018-07-26
Object 1.建立Object執行個體的方式有兩種: var person=new Object();person.name="zx";person.age=19; 對象字面量標記法: var person={ name:"zx", age:19}; 住意每兩個屬性中間用逗號分隔,最後一個屬性後面沒有逗號,結尾要加分號。
Time of Update: 2018-07-26
執行個體一:讓文字框只帶有底線 <script type="text/javascript"> function changeTextStyle(){ //讓文字框只帶有底線 //獲得文字框的DOM var myText = document.getElementById("myText");
Time of Update: 2018-07-26
一個用JS寫的滑鼠左擊特效 點擊滑鼠左鍵會出現紅心””或者字元表情“(๑•́ ₃ •̀๑)”… 常用Emoji 可以自行替換,如需複製,請從底部連結移步至Github 代碼 onload = function() { var click_cnt = 0; var $html = document.getElementsByTagName("html")[0]; var $body =
Time of Update: 2018-07-26
我們肯定都很熟悉商品購物車這一功能,每當我們在某寶某東上購買商品的時候,看中了哪件商品,就會加入購物車中,最後結算。購物車這一功能,方便消費者對商品進行管理,可以添加商品,刪除商品,選中購物車中的某一項或幾項商品,最後商品總價也會隨著消費者的操作隨著變化。